On Mon, Jul 23, 2018 at 11:37:06PM +0200, Cédric Le Goater wrote:
> On 07/18/2018 08:12 AM, David Gibson wrote:
> >> +static void pnv_phb3_get_phb_id(Object *obj, Visitor *v, const char *name,
> >> +                              void *opaque, Error **errp)
> >> +{
> >> +    Property *prop = opaque;
> >> +    uint32_t *ptr = qdev_get_prop_ptr(DEVICE(obj), prop);
> >> +
> >> +    visit_type_uint32(v, name, ptr, errp);
> >> +}
> >> +
> >> +static void pnv_phb3_set_phb_id(Object *obj, Visitor *v, const char *name,
> >> +                              void *opaque, Error **errp)
> >> +{
> >> +    PnvPHB3 *phb = PNV_PHB3(obj);
> >> +    uint32_t phb_id;
> >> +    Error *local_err = NULL;
> >> +
> >> +    visit_type_uint32(v, name, &phb_id, &local_err);
> >> +    if (local_err) {
> >> +        error_propagate(errp, local_err);
> >> +        return;
> >> +    }
> >> +
> >> +    /*
> >> +     * Limit to a maximum of 6 PHBs per chip
> >> +     */
> >> +    if (phb_id >= PNV8_CHIP_PHB3_MAX) {
> >> +        error_setg(errp, "invalid PHB index: '%d'", phb_id);
> >> +        return;
> >> +    }
> >> +
> >> +    phb->phb_id = phb_id;
> >> +}
> >> +
> >> +static const PropertyInfo pnv_phb3_phb_id_propinfo = {
> >> +    .name = "irq",
> >> +    .get = pnv_phb3_get_phb_id,
> >> +    .set = pnv_phb3_set_phb_id,
> >> +};
> > Can't you use a static DeviceProps style property for this, which is a
> > bit simpler?
> 
> yes but we will need these ops for user creatable devices. This is where
> we will check the chip id.

Why?  Can't we check that during realize()?  That's a common pattern
for static properties.
